Corin, as discussed, the plan to outsource tier-one support to Quillan Serviceworks is at contract-draft stage. Sales leads should know response SLAs stay at four hours and escalations remain in-house with the Penrow team. Staffing transition runs over two quarters; no customer-facing disruption expected. Keep messaging neutral until the announcement. The pricing rationale and margin targets are summarised in the confidential note that follows.

management briefing: Istaelix Group is in early talks to buy Sorysax Logistics for about $496.2 million. The Kasox launch date is October 3, and nothing goes to the press before then. Legal wants the Norokax Foods term sheet withdrawn before April 25.

Handover note — Gridwright sort stability fix (for Marit, release manager)

Tobin, here's where things stand before I'm out. The instability in Gridwright's multi-column report sorting traced back to the comparator falling through to an unstable native sort when columns contained mixed nulls. I've patched the comparator to treat nulls as a distinct, stable tier and added regression tests covering three-column stacks. The fix is merged but not yet tagged for release. Full details, test matrix, and rollback notes are on the internal page below.

wiki page, tahaf-tajog: https://jira.ordindyn.corp/pipeline

Ticket: Per-tenant rate quotas on the Quillbox API. Right now a single noisy tenant can chew through the shared burst pool and starve everyone else, which is obviously not great. We want to move to isolated token buckets per tenant with configurable ceilings and alerting when a tenant hits 80%. Nothing too exotic, but since it touches auth middleware we need a security pass. The reviewer responsible for sign-off is listed below.

account owner for fajep-yagef: Kasix Eliiel

Heads up: the color-contrast accessibility audit for the Plumtree checkout flow is handled by Lanternview Accessibility, our outside vendor. They re-scan every release candidate and file findings straight into our tracker under the a11y-audit tag. If a release is blocked on a contrast finding you think is a false positive, don't just override it — Lanternview can fast-track a re-review, usually same day. Their auditor on our account is quick to respond.

escalation mailbox, bafog-fafog: ulador@paliqlabs.internal